Old Cook Home. Excerpt from Recorded Historical landmark 1968: 

Historical home built in 1873 in Victorian style, with large bay windows. Solid Walnut staircase brought over from Louisiana during the time of building. 3 fireplaces. It was remodeled in the past but retains the original floor plan. The house was bought in 1890 by Judge J.G. Cook, a noted lawyer, and remained in the Cook family for several generations. Designated by Governor John Connally.
